Background

Weyco Group filed an 8-K (Item 1.02) stating its board authorized termination of its pension plan and related trust, effective Aug. 31, 2026, subject to PBGC standard termination procedures.

Context

Weyco authorized termination of its pension plan effective Aug. 31, 2026, subject to PBGC review, with no expected additional cash contributions due to overfunding.

Expected impact

Likely limited immediate impact; any reaction would hinge on market interpretation of PBGC review risk and settlement timing rather than new funding needs.

Evidence & confidence

The 8-K is a primary disclosure of a material definitive agreement termination, but it explicitly notes overfunded status and no expected additional cash contributions; the main uncertainty is timing/nature of participant settlements and PBGC review outcomes.
